Oral History Interview with Ray Robinson, June 25, 1979
Interview with Ray Robinson regarding his experiences in the military and as a prisoner of war of the Japanese during World War II. He was part of the Texas National Guard, 36th Division, 131st Field Artillery, 2nd Battalion, also known as the "Lost Battalion." He was captured on the island of Java in March of 1942 and spent the duration of the war thereafter as a prison of war in camps in South East Asia and in Japan.

Inventory of county records, Comal County courthouse, New Braunfels, Texas
Inventory of the records of Comal County. Begins with an introduction and explanation of the roles of various county government offices. Describes the records of the County Clerk as Secretary for Commissioners Court, County Clerk as Recorder, County Clerk as Reporter for County Court, District Clerk, Tax Assessor-Collector, Justice of the Peace, Sheriff, County Judge, County Treasurer, Auditor, Road Administrator, and County Attorney. Includes an index as well as a listing of county records housed in Sophienburg Memorial Museum.
